So, 'Unification Of Japan 9' is this interesting mix of action and crime drama that dives deep into the underbelly of yakuza life. You get a real sense of the tension brewing as Himuro, played by Yasukaze Motomiya, steps up as the Yamasaki-gumi Wakagashira. The pacing feels deliberate, building a thick atmosphere of impending conflict, especially with the Genseikai group looming over him. What caught my attention was the practical effects; they really ground the action in a gritty realism that often gets lost in flashy CGI. The performances are immersive, bringing a layer of depth to the characters' struggles with loyalty and power. It's got that raw energy that you might not find in more polished films.
